Red Hat Training

A Red Hat training course is available for Red Hat Enterprise Linux

4.4. 建立隔離裝置

下列指令會建立一項 stonith 裝置。
pcs stonith create stonith_id stonith_device_type [stonith_device_options]
# pcs stonith create MyStonith fence_virt pcmk_host_list=f1 op monitor interval=30s 
若您在多個節點之間使用單一隔離裝置,並且各個節點皆使用不同連接埠的話,您無須為各個節點個別建立一項裝置。您可使用 pcmk_host_map 選項來定義哪個連接埠連接哪個節點來代替。比方說,下列 指令會建立單一隔離裝置名為 myapc-west-13,該隔離裝置使用了一個名為 west-apc 的 APC powerswitch,並且使用了連接埠 15 來連至 west-13
# pcs stonith create myapc-west-13 fence_apc pcmk_host_list="west-13" ipaddr="west-apc" login="apc" passwd="apc" port="15"
然而下列範例使用了名為 west-apc 的 APC powerswitch 來隔離使用連接埠 15 的 west-13 節點、使用連接埠 17 的 west-14 節點、使用連接埠 18 的 west-15 節點,以及使用連接埠 19 的 west-16 節點。
# pcs stonith create myapc fence_apc pcmk_host_list="west-13,west-14,west-15,west-16" pcmk_host_map="west-13:15;west-14:17;west-15:18;west-16:19" ipaddr="west-apc" login="apc" passwd="apc"